    How Steel Plate Body Armor is Manufactured: The Production Process and Quality Control Measures

    Steel plate body armor is a type of personal protective equipment that provides a high level of protection against ballistic threats. The manufacturing process of steel plate body armor is complex and involves a number of different steps to ensure that the final product is of the highest quality. In this article, we will explore the production process and quality control measures that are used to manufacture steel plate body armor.

    Step 1: Material Selection

    The first step in the manufacturing process is the selection of materials. Steel plate body armor is typically made from high-quality, high-hardness steel that is designed to withstand ballistic impacts. The steel is carefully selected to ensure that it meets specific requirements for hardness, strength, and toughness.

    Step 2: Cutting

    Once the steel has been selected, it is cut into the required size and shape using precision cutting tools. This is a critical step in the manufacturing process, as the accuracy of the cuts can affect the ballistic performance of the armor.

    Step 3: Bending and Forming

    After the steel has been cut, it is bent and formed into the desired shape using specialized equipment. This process is used to create the curvature of the armor, which is important for optimizing its ballistic performance.

    Step 4: Heat Treatment

    Once the steel has been cut and formed, it undergoes a heat treatment process to increase its hardness and strength. This involves heating the steel to a specific temperature and then quenching it in water or oil to rapidly cool it. This process is carefully controlled to ensure that the steel achieves the desired hardness and strength while avoiding cracking or other defects.

    Step 5: Surface Treatment

    After the heat treatment process, the steel is subjected to a surface treatment to improve its durability and corrosion resistance. This may involve applying a coating or plating to the surface of the armor.

    Step 6: Quality Control

    Throughout the manufacturing process, a number of quality control measures are used to ensure that the final product meets strict standards for performance and safety. These measures may include non-destructive testing to detect any defects in the steel, as well as ballistic testing to evaluate the armor’s ability to stop various types of projectiles.

    Step 7: Assembly

    Once the individual steel plates have been manufactured and tested, they are assembled into a complete body armor system. This may involve attaching the plates to a carrier or vest, as well as adding other components such as trauma pads or ballistic panels.

    Step 8: Final Inspection

    Before the body armor is released for use, it undergoes a final inspection to ensure that it meets all applicable standards and regulations. This may involve additional ballistic testing, as well as a visual inspection to check for any defects or damage.
